Simple project documenting my "lasercutter wet clay" shaping process.  


The Process
-----------

While fooling around with technology I discovered that wet clay may be very easily manipulated using the common `K40` 40 W CO₂-Lasercutter.  

This works essentially by vaporising the water very quickly and thus ablating huge portions of the clay at once.  

The following usage modes are the ones already discovered by me:
- `fine mark`: power=`100%`  speed=`20-60mm/s`  inFocus=`True`  
- `coarse mark`: power=`100%`  speed=`5-15mm/s`  inFocus=`False`  (3mm line width is no big deal!)  
- `engrave`: power=`100%`  speed=`20-60mm/s`  inFocus=`True`  
- `vitrify`: power=`100%`  speed=`4-12mm/s`  inFocus=`True`  

Note: For deep cuts one has to repeat the marking operation many many times, depending on thickness and speed setting as one iteration only removes a little material and going slower as one would with other material just results in the vitrification of the clay.
